Abstract

PROBLEM TO BE SOLVED: To provide a bar-shaped object holder excellent in generality, capable of simplifying assembly work and reducing cost and improving working efficiency in the case of applying it to a vehicle, etc. SOLUTION: A clip part 2 is furnished with at least two member insertion and extraction port for installation installing directions to a bracket 4 of which cross each other on the same flat surface on a bar-shaped object holder 1 having the clip part 2 to be installed on the bracket 4 free to insert in and extract from it and a clamp part 3 integrally formed with the clip part 2 and free to elastically deform to hold bar-shaped objects such as a meter cable 21, an accelerator cable 22, etc., free to insert in and extract from it.

BACKGROUND OF THE INVENTION 1. Field of the Invention The present invention relates to a rod-like object holder for holding a rod-like object such as a cable such as an accelerator cable or a meter cable, a hose such as a washer hose, a pipe, or a rod, for example, in an automobile.

Description of the Related Art As a rod-like holder for holding a rod-like body on a vehicle body or the like, for example, as disclosed in Japanese Utility Model Laid-Open Publication No. 3-46083, it can be inserted into and removed from a mounting member such as a bracket mounted on the vehicle body. And a pair of cylindrical clamp portions formed integrally with the clip portion and each holding a rod-shaped object detachably.

In this rod holder, a pair of clamp portions are provided at a distance from the clip portion in the height direction with their respective axial directions orthogonal to each other, and formed on the peripheral wall of each clip portion in the axial direction. By pushing a rod-like object such as a hose from the opening using the elastic deformation of the peripheral wall, and pushing the clip part into a mounting member attached to the vehicle body and mounting it,
The rod is held on the vehicle body.

However, in the above-mentioned conventional bar-shaped object holder, the clip portion is formed so as to be pushed into the mounting member only from one predetermined direction and mounted.
The positional relationship between the pair of clamp portions with respect to the mounting member is fixed.

For this reason, when the bar-shaped object layout is changed due to a difference in the specifications of the vehicle or the component layout of a portion for holding the bar-shaped object is different, various bar-shaped object holders corresponding to the layout must be prepared. In addition, it lacks versatility, increases the manufacturing cost and the parts management cost, and also complicates the assembling work, which may cause a reduction in work efficiency.

Accordingly, an object of the present invention made in view of such a point is to provide a rod-shaped object which is excellent in versatility, simplifies assembling work, and can reduce cost and improve work efficiency when applied to a vehicle or the like. It is to provide a holder.
